Airbus Launches Cargo Airline with Whale-Shaped Super Transporter

Specialized Beluga freighter that ferries aircraft components will be available for hire by the general market.

Key Takeaways:

  • Airbus is commercializing its distinctive Beluga ST supersize jets, launching "Airbus Beluga Transport" to offer specialized outsized cargo services to external customers.
  • This new service targets various sectors for large cargo transport, leveraging the Beluga's unparalleled interior cross-section for items like pre-assembled helicopters and large aircraft engines.
  • The initiative involves phasing out Airbus's internal Beluga ST fleet, as they are replaced by newer Beluga XLs, and dedicating the STs to this new full-time commercial contract carrier operation.

Airbus said Tuesday it is commercializing its in-house fleet of Beluga supersize jets used to transport large aircraft components between manufacturing sites to offer logistics companies and other organizations airlift for outsized shipments.
